Before Ron Burgundy and the Channel 4 Evening News Team take over in December, it looks like another bastion of “journalism” will make its Newseum debut: The Today show.

As the long-running morning talk show is set to undergo a facelift, WTOP and The Huffington Post report that pieces from the show’s old set are currently on their way to a new permanent home at 555 Pennsylvania Avenue NW. Today confirmed the news in a tweet.
